Hi

Am 23.05.21 um 19:04 schrieb Paul Cercueil:
> V5 of my patchset which adds the option for having GEM buffers backed by
> non-coherent memory.
> 
> Changes from V4:
> 
> - [2/3]:
>      - Rename to drm_fb_cma_sync_non_coherent
>      - Invert loops for better cache locality
>      - Only sync BOs that have the non-coherent flag
>      - Properly sort includes
>      - Move to drm_fb_cma_helper.c to avoid circular dependency

I'm pretty sure it's still not the right place. That would be something 
like drm_gem_cma_atomic_helper.c, but creating a new file just for a 
single function doesn't make sense.

> 
> - [3/3]:
>      - Fix drm_atomic_get_new_plane_state() used to retrieve the old
>        state
>      - Use custom drm_gem_fb_create()

It's often a better choice to express such differences via different 
data structures (i.e., different instances of drm_mode_config_funcs) but 
it's not a big deal either.

Please go ahaed and merge if no one objects. All patches:

Acked-by: Thomas Zimmermann <tzimmermann@suse.de>
